Most people think a real estate agent simply shows houses
That is only a small part of what actually happens
A real estate agent is responsible for guiding one of the largest financial decisions in a person life
Every step requires strategy and timing
The process starts long before a home is ever shown
It starts with understanding the market conditions
We study recent sales in the area
We compare location size and condition
We evaluate demand from active buyers
We look at how quickly similar homes are selling
Then we determine a pricing strategy
Pricing is not guessing it is data driven analysis
A strong price can create competition among buyers
A weak price can leave money on the table
Once pricing is set preparation begins
We help sellers understand what improvements matter
Not every upgrade increases value
Some changes are unnecessary and waste money
Next comes marketing preparation
This includes photos video and presentation
First impressions are critical in real estate
Most buyers decide quickly based on visuals
We position the home online for maximum exposure
This includes multiple platforms and targeted reach
We also prepare the listing description carefully
Words influence how buyers feel about the property
Once the home is live we monitor activity closely
We track views showings and buyer feedback
We adjust strategy if needed based on response
Real estate is active not passive
Now we move into the buyer side of the process
A real estate agent also represents buyers every day
We help buyers understand what they can realistically afford
This includes loan limits and monthly payment comfort
We help buyers narrow down neighborhoods
Lifestyle commute and schools all matter
We schedule and coordinate property tours
Time and access are managed efficiently
We point out details buyers may not notice
Structure condition and long term value
When a buyer is ready we prepare an offer
This is where strategy becomes very important
We analyze comparable sales to support the offer price
We protect the buyer from overpaying
We structure terms beyond just price
Closing dates contingencies and credits all matter
We submit the offer and communicate with the listing agent
Negotiation begins immediately after
We work to get the best possible outcome
This requires experience and timing
Once an offer is accepted escrow begins
Escrow is the official closing process
We coordinate inspections and reports
Every detail of the property is reviewed
We help interpret inspection results for the client
Not everything found requires repair or concern
We negotiate repairs or credits when needed
This protects the buyer or seller financially
We stay on top of appraisal process
Lenders must confirm the home value
We manage deadlines carefully
Missing deadlines can risk the entire transaction
We communicate constantly with all parties
Lender escrow and agents must stay aligned
If problems come up we solve them quickly
Real estate deals often face unexpected issues
We handle document corrections and compliance items
Accuracy is essential for closing
We keep emotions from disrupting decisions
Transactions can become stressful without guidance
We push the deal forward even when challenges arise
Momentum is key in escrow
As closing approaches final walkthrough is completed
The property must be in agreed condition
We confirm all documents are signed correctly
Small errors can delay closing
Funds are transferred through escrow securely
Everything is verified before completion
Finally the transaction closes
Ownership officially changes hands
Keys are delivered and the process is complete
But support does not end there
We remain a resource after closing
Clients often need guidance even after moving in
A real estate agent is not just a door opener
We are negotiators planners and problem solvers
We manage risk and protect financial outcomes
We guide people through one of the biggest decisions of their life
That is what a real estate agent actually does
